♻️ Reducing Waste in the
Operating Room
Operating rooms generate a significant amount of medical
waste. This session highlights:
- Waste
audits and segregation strategies
- Reducing
unnecessary surgical supplies
- Optimizing
instrument trays
- Preventing
excessive use of disposable materials
These approaches help minimize waste while maintaining
clinical efficiency.
⚡ Energy Efficiency and Equipment
Optimization
Energy consumption in surgical facilities is high. Key
strategies include:
- Optimizing
HVAC systems and lighting
- Energy-efficient
surgical equipment usage
- Smart
monitoring of power consumption
- Reducing
idle energy loads in operating rooms
These measures support both cost savings and
environmental sustainability.
π Sustainable Procurement
and Device Life-Cycles
Healthcare procurement plays a vital role in sustainability:
- Choosing
reusable vs. single-use devices
- Prioritizing
durable and repairable equipment
- Reducing
packaging waste
- Evaluating
life-cycle impact of medical devices
Sustainable procurement ensures long-term environmental and
economic benefits.
π«️ Environmental Impact
of Anesthetic Gases
Anesthetic gases contribute significantly to greenhouse
emissions. This session explores:
- Low-flow
anesthesia techniques
- Selection
of environmentally safer agents
- Monitoring
anesthetic gas emissions
- Balancing
patient safety with environmental responsibility
